        Weight conversion is a simple yet crucial process that involves converting one unit of measurement to another. In this case, we're converting kilograms to pounds. To do this, we'll use the following conversion factor: 1 kilogram is equivalent to 2.20462 pounds. Using this factor, we can easily convert 75 kilograms to pounds by multiplying 75 by 2.20462.

    • Kilograms and pounds are two different units of measurement, with 1 kilogram being equivalent to 2.20462 pounds. This difference is essential to understand when converting weight measurements.
